Under Resistance fire, IOF withdraw from Tubas

Resistance fighters confronted Israeli forces as they stormed the town of Aqaba, north of Tubas, with confrontations centered around a house that was surrounded by the occupation forces.

Al Mayadeen's correspondent reported on Saturday the withdrawal of Israeli forces from the Tubas Governorate in the northeastern West Bank.

The withdrawal came as a result of Palestinian resistance strikes and their defense against Israeli incursions.

On Saturday, Israeli occupation forces stormed the town of Aqaba, located north of Tubas in the northeastern West Bank, surrounding a house. The storming was accompanied by widespread reconnaissance flights overhead, casting a heavy surveillance presence across the area. 

As additional forces were deployed to the town, they were confronted by Resistance fighters, who engaged the forces in violent confrontations.

According to the Palestinian News Agency, WAFA, a 50-year-old man was shot by Israeli occupation forces, who also detained a local youth.

The Tubas Battalion of the al-Quds Brigades reported engaging in intense confrontations with Israeli occupation forces around the house in Aqaba. During the confrontations, the fighters targeted Israeli infantry units and sniper positions with heavy fire.

Amid the ongoing confrontations around the besieged house, the al-Quds Brigades successfully detonated a pre-positioned explosive device targeting the Israeli occupation vehicles that were storming the town.

Meanwhile, the al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igades in Tubas engaged Israeli forces in intense gunfire exchanges using machine guns, focusing their resistance around the house that was under siege.

Israeli military bulldozer targeted in Nablus 

In Nablus, in the northern West Bank, confrontations broke out between Resistance fighters and Israeli occupation forces as they stormed the Askar al-Jadeed camp. During the confrontations, the fighters successfully targeted an Israeli military bulldozer with an explosive device near the camp.

During the raid, Israeli forces opened fire on local Resistance fighters. Additionally, the occupation forces expanded their raid, storming the city of Tulkarm, located northwest of the West Bank.

They also raided the towns of Birzeit and Kobar, north of Ramallah. In Kobar, Israeli forces opened fire on a vehicle during the raid and raided Palestinian homes, where they conducted field interrogations.
